Hey Ria c: So which part we stuck on? Both?\[\Large\rm f(x)=\cases{3x-2, &$x\le1$\\ \rm \frac{1}{2}x^3, &$x\gt1$}\]

OpenStudy (ria23):

Hi! ^.^ Yes... The fist one, I was thinking I plug in -2 for x, but I wasn't sure...

zepdrix (zepdrix):

So your function is piece-wise. It's two different functions, but never both at the same time. f(-2) corresponds to x=-2. When x is -2, which part should we use? The top line or the bottom? (Read the restrictions to the right of each piece, after the commas)

zepdrix (zepdrix):

-2 is `less than` 1. Which inequality is going to hold true? :o

OpenStudy (ria23):

Uh... The first one?

zepdrix (zepdrix):

Mmm good good \(\Large\rm -2\le1\).

zepdrix (zepdrix):

\[\Large\rm f(-2)=\cases{\color{orangered}{3(-2)-2, }&$x\le1$\\ \rm \frac{1}{2}x^3, &$x\gt1$}\]

zepdrix (zepdrix):

So what do we get for f(-2)? :o

zepdrix (zepdrix):

Maybe it would make more sense to look at the first line instead of the entire function since we're dealing with x=-2: \[\Large\rm f(x)=3(x)-2, \qquad \qquad x\le1\]\[\Large\rm f(-2)=3(-2)-2, \qquad \qquad x\le1\]

zepdrix (zepdrix):

So whatchu get? :d

OpenStudy (ria23):

\[-8, x \le 1\]

zepdrix (zepdrix):

f(-2)= -8 Ok good c:
